Finally snagged a res two months ago and here to chronicle the experience!1. Kumamoto Oysterreally enjoyed how the flavors transition in your mouth -- it started off with a slightly briny, soy-sauced based cucumber sauce, but the oyster itself was light and a bit sweet due to the watermelon pearls that it was covered in2. Hamachiagain hit me with that flavor bending -- this one was seasoned really well with the hamachi and banana pepper entering your mouth first before the wasabi hidden underneath the fish and rice took over. another one for the books!3. Hokkaido Sea Urchin & White Sturgeon Caviarcreamy uni and caviar packaged into a bite-sized packet of flavor! really liked the creamy texture and non oceanicness of the uni4. Kinmedaiplum vinaigrette definitely stole the show on this one -- great combo with the shiso leaf5. Wild Spot Prawntwo types of spices complemented each other nicely -- texture on prawn was great too!6. Ora King Salmonfavorite one so far!! not sure what moromi is but the ginger scallion oil was on point!!7. Housemade Fingerling Potato Chipnew favorite one so far!! as a bit of a truffle enjoyer myself, they really hit me up with a thick homeslice of beefy black truffle. 11/10 would eat again.8. Fresh Kumamoto Oysterwasabi had a strong kick in the back of the mouth which was really interesting -- fried oyster super yummy and squid ink actually tasting like squid chips, yummy!9. Kyoto Style Black Trumpet Mushroomcan't go wrong with mushroom -- the soy sauce and umami was really good at the beginning but i think i chewed it for too long and at the end i was just munching on the trumpets, which was a pretty interesting experience10. Yuzu Kosho Niboshi Brothpersonally, not a big fan of this one. it serves its purpose of transitioning between nigiri and sashimi, but the flavors were a little too strong for my taste11. Shima Aji & Hokkaido Sea Urchinwe burrito'd this one up -- first dish in the sashimi portion of the menu! the ceviche vinaigrette was v unique!12. Hamachi (part 2)really captured the thai taste with the seasoning on this one!! i enjoyed thoroughly13. Ora King Salmon (part 2)more of a classic salmon flavor here -- i think the fish itself was emphasized for me and was a nice bite!14, 15. Bluefin Maguro Oaxaca, ToroComparatively, I think the Oaxaca looked more appetizing but the Toro was fattier and an overall more enjoyable cut. Cool of them to put two tunas together though16. Bay ScallopA really tender, juicy scallop with truffle on top! Great taste and three bites instead of one so we could enjoy the flavor for longer.17. Grilled Maitake, Shiitake, and King Oyster MushroomThis was a nice change of pace from the rest of the menu, and each mushroom definitely had its own distinct crunch or taste -- i could eat twenty plates of these for sure haha18. Wagyu KushiyakiWagyu never fails to amaze my tastebuds -- three chunks on a skewer were enough to make me go mmmm... the seasoning was also a nice touch!19. Foie GrasTeriyaki Foie Gras flavoring was pretty interesting, but not as memorable as the other dishes.20. Something Sweet - Yuzu Curd MeringueI may be biased as a Yuzu fanatic, but this was a banger to end off the meal on, and left me craving more the next day!Overall,Experience took ~2.5 hours with more time in between later dishes than earlier ones (perhaps because they became more busy), and the wait staff was very nice! Not sure if I'd go back given the price point but it was definitely worth experiencing at least once!!
